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Miami International Holdings, Inc. director Eric Sites filed an initial ownership report showing fully vested nonqualified stock options linked to the company’s shares. The options cover 9,174 underlying shares at an exercise price of $20.0000, 9,554 shares at $19.8400, 7,500 shares at $25.9800, and 7,500 shares at $16.1400, all expiring on March 26, 2030. A footnote notes that Sites was elected to the Board of Directors on April 24, 2026 and that Horizon Kinetics Asset Management LLC separately reported beneficial ownership of 11,162,809 shares on an amended Schedule 13D.

A Schedule 13D is a legal document that investors file with regulators when they buy a large enough stake in a company to potentially influence its management or decisions. It provides details about the investor’s intention, ownership stake, and plans, helping other investors understand who is gaining control and what their motives might be.

Beneficial ownership means the person or entity that actually enjoys the benefits of owning shares or other assets — such as receiving dividends, voting rights, or price gains — even if the legal title is held in another name. For investors it matters because knowing who truly controls and profits from a company reveals who can influence decisions, exposes potential conflicts of interest or hidden concentration of power, and affects transparency and risk in the stock.
